Overview

KITPF3000FRDMPGM from NXP Semiconductors is a development kit for the PF3000 power management IC, designed to evaluate and prototype power solutions for i.MX 7 and i.MX 6SL/SX/UL application processors. It supports full-system power delivery with four buck regulators (up to 2.75 A combined), six LDOs, RTC supply, coin-cell charging, and DDR reference voltage generation. The kit enables validation of dynamic voltage scaling, I²C-programmable startup sequences, and low-power modes in tablet, wearable, and industrial control designs.

Technical Context

The KITPF3000FRDMPGM implements the PF3000 PMIC in a 48-pin QFN (7.0 mm × 7.0 mm, wettable flank) package with VIN input range support of 2.8–4.5 V or 3.7–5.5 V via VPWR. It integrates four buck converters (SW1A/B configurable as 1.0 A + 1.75 A or 2.75 A single-phase), one boost regulator (5.0–5.15 V, 600 mA), seven LDOs including VCC_SD (dual-voltage SD card support), V33 (350 mA), VLDO2 (0.8–1.55 V, 250 mA), and VREFDDR (0.5×VDDR, 10 mA).

It features OTP-programmable startup sequence (15-slot timing with 0.5/2.0 ms resolution), dynamic voltage scaling (PWM/PFM/APS modes), I²C address configuration (0x08–0x0F), PWRON edge/level sensitivity, and STANDBY/RESETBMCU/INTB logic interface signals. The kit includes on-board coin-cell charging circuitry, VSNVS 3.0 V always-on rail, and traceable ground references (GNDREF1/GNDREF2/GNDREF) for noise-sensitive analog regulation.

Key Specifications

Parameter Value and Actual Design Meaning
Target IC PF3000 PMIC - fully validated reference design for i.MX 7 & i.MX 6SL/SX/UL processors
Input Voltage Support 2.8–4.5 V (VIN) or 3.7–5.5 V (VPWR with external PFET) - enables flexible system-level power architecture
Buck Regulator Config SW1A (1.0 A) + SW1B (1.75 A) or combined 2.75 A - supports core voltage scaling for ARM Cortex-A7/A9 cores
LDO Count & Key Outputs 7 LDOs: VCC_SD (100 mA, dual-voltage SDIO), V33 (350 mA), VLDO2 (250 mA, 0.8–1.55 V), VREFDDR (10 mA, DDR memory reference)
OTP Programmability User-configurable startup sequence, regulator voltages, I²C address (0x08–0x0F), PWRON mode, DVS ramp rate - eliminates external configuration components
Interface Signals I²C (SCL/SDA/VDDIO), INTB (open-drain fault interrupt), RESETBMCU (programmable POR/fault reset), STANDBY, PWRON, SD_VSEL - direct integration with i.MX host logic
Package & Thermal 48-pin QFN, 7.0 mm × 7.0 mm, wettable flank - supports automated optical inspection and high-density PCB layout

FAQ

What is the primary function of the KITPF3000FRDMPGM evaluation kit?

The KITPF3000FRDMPGM evaluation kit provides a fully assembled, tested hardware platform for validating the PF3000 power management IC in systems based on NXP i.MX 7 and i.MX 6SL/SX/UL processors. It includes pre-programmed OTP configurations, reference schematics, debug headers, and documentation to accelerate power architecture development - not a standalone IC, but a turnkey solution for evaluating the KITPF3000FRDMPGM's buck/LDO performance, sequencing behavior, and low-power mode operation.

Which i.MX processor variants does the KITPF3000FRDMPGM support out-of-the-box?

The KITPF3000FRDMPGM supports multiple i.MX processor configurations via factory-programmed OTP options, including i.MX 7 with DDR3L (option A1), i.MX 7 with LPDDR3 (A2), i.MX 6SX with DDR3L (A3), i.MX 6SX with DDR3 (A4), i.MX 6SL with LPDDR2 (A5), i.MX 6UL with LPDDR2 (A6), i.MX 6UL with DDR3L (A7), and i.MX 6UL with DDR3 (A8). Each variant maps directly to a specific KITPF3000FRDMPGM firmware image and reference schematic.

Does the KITPF3000FRDMPGM include hardware for coin-cell backup and RTC power?

Yes, the KITPF3000FRDMPGM includes dedicated circuitry for coin-cell charging and VSNVS (3.0 V, 1.0 mA) supply, enabling persistent RTC operation during main power loss. The board provides a socketed coin-cell holder, current-limited charging path, and biasing for the LICELL pin per PF3000 specifications - allowing engineers to verify battery-backed SNVS domain functionality in KITPF3000FRDMPGM-based designs.

Can the KITPF3000FRDMPGM be used to test dynamic voltage scaling (DVS) on i.MX processor cores?

Yes, the KITPF3000FRDMPGM enables full DVS validation using SW1A and SW1B buck regulators, which support programmable output voltages (0.7–1.425 V / 0.7–1.475 V), PWM/PFM/APS operating modes, and software-controlled ramp rates. Engineers can issue I²C commands to adjust KITPF3000FRDMPGM regulator outputs in real time while monitoring core performance and power consumption - confirming voltage transition timing, stability, and transient response per i.MX DVFS requirements.

What debug and programming interfaces are provided on the KITPF3000FRDMPGM board?

The KITPF3000FRDMPGM board includes an I²C bus header (SCL/SDA/VDDIO) with pull-up resistors, JTAG/SWD debug connector compatible with standard NXP LPC-Link2 probes, PWRON/STANDBY/RESETBMCU logic-level test points, and INTB fault interrupt monitoring pins. These interfaces allow real-time register read/write, OTP reprogramming (via supported tools), power state tracing, and fault injection - all essential for comprehensive KITPF3000FRDMPGM system validation.
